    Source : INDIA TODAY NEWSX, the social media platform owned by Elon Musk, says the Indian government has asked it to block access to over 8,000 accounts in the country. The company says it has begun complying with the executive orders but has expressed disagreement with the demands saying they amount to censorship and are against the fundamental right of free speech. According to X, the Indian government has not provided justification or evidence for the blocking requests.

    Source : INDIA TODAY NEWSApple is reportedly looking for more time to comply with a recent US court order that requires the company to allow developers to direct users outside of the App Store for in-app purchases. Apple is not allowed to charge any commission for these payments. According to a report by Bloomberg, as it promised, Apple has appealed the ruling and has asked the court to pause the order.
